Lol here are list of your confusion
1. Current/voltage/resistance all three are interdependent and all can kill you it’s not only voltage
2. You said that 1000amp don’t kill human that’s totally foolish …current flows depends on resistance … maybe 1000 amp current you are saying is for metallic conductor but that value of current can’t pass through humans body is it doesn’t have enough voltage
3. If welding machine is set to 50 amp means it’s the current for metal conductor not every object ,for other objects it depends on resistance of that body
EG……
For 50amp rated welding machine
human body resistance is roughly 8000 ohms and voltage due to step down is 54 volts .. if you touch the welding machine then I=54/8000=6.75 mil amp so it can’t kill you
But in cast iron that you are welding , resistance is very very low r=1 ohms (say) so I =54/1=54 amp ( this value is rated in transformers casing )that’s why current that flows in cast iron is 54 amp but same current drops to 6.75 miliamp when human body comes
So this game is all about resistance and voltage
